    I have made several gathered end hammocks, so this time, I'm going to change things up a little. I'm doing one of the channel ends with a continuios loop or dog bone through the channel, like the ENOs are made. And I'm going to add a bugnet with a zipper on both sides. I tend to switch left and right directions when sleeping. Putting a zipper on both sides means I don't have to worry about which way I set it up, or which side I get out on. It will also allow me to reach out both sides and adjust the UQ. Waiting another couple of days for the fabric is not a big deal, as I am waiting until payday to order my net and zipper from DIY Gear Supply.........RR
